A Concise Summary and Outline of "Esquisse d'un Programme": edit

An influential research proposal submitted by Alexander Grothendieck in 1984 that continues to inspire even today several related areas of mathematics. Of considerable interest to many mathematicians are the recent Galois groupoid and categorical generalizations of Galois theory initiated by Alexander Grothendieck, now developed towards maturity by several other seasoned mathematicians.

In the second section of the Esquisse Grothendieck sketched what he called the "Galois-Teichm\"uller theory"--a study of the abstract Galois group   via the action of this group on the mapping class (Teichm\"uller) groups; the latter are the fundamental groups of the moduli spaces of Riemann surfaces with marked points. Then, in the third section he focuses on the `simple' but non-trivial case of the smallest moduli space of spheres with four ordered marked points. The Galois action on the fundamental group of this space--which is the profinite completion of the free group on two generators leads to the "dessin d' enfants". The generalization of this theme to all moduli spaces discussed in the second section was the subject of a 1995 mathematics conference published as the "Geometric Galois Actions: The inverse Galois." (London Mathematical Series No. 243, Cambridge University Press., Leila Schneps and Pierre Lochak, Eds. )
